    This clip is from episode #260 of The Drive - Men's sexual health: Why it matters, what can go wrong, and how to fix it | Mohit Khera, M.D., M.B.A., M.P.H.
    In this episode, Peter is joined by Mohit Khera, M.D., M.B.A., M.P.H., a world-renowned urologist with expertise in sexual medicine and testosterone therapy
    In this clip, we discuss:
    - What are Clomid and Enclomifene and how do they work?
    - What is Klinefelter syndrome
    - How do medications for low testosterone effect fertility?

    • @banana_1992
      @banana_1992 7 місяців тому

      @@mirapilates most important pituitary hormone for testosterone is LH (luteinizing hormone), which is what stimulates the testes to produce testosterone. However be mindful that even if your LH is normal/high, the testes may simply be unresponsive (primary hypogonadism) resulting in low T regardless of how much upstream stimulation they are receiving from the brain pituitary gland. Look up “HPTA” for more info (hypothalamic-pituitary-testicular axis)
